How it works
Understanding compound interest
Why a lump sum grows so strongly over time.
The formula behind it
Capital × (1 + return)^years — every year, not just the starting capital but also the gains already earned get compounded.
Lump sum vs. savings plan
With a lump sum, the entire capital works from day one — the savings plan calculator shows the effect of adding a monthly contribution on top.
The time factor
Compounding accelerates exponentially over time — the last years of a long horizon often contribute the most.

Compound interest means gains aren't paid out but reinvested and earn further gains themselves — so capital grows faster over time than with simple interest.

The calculator assumes a constant annual return and doesn't account for taxes, fees, or market swings — it's a rough guide, not financial advice.
